Archived: Free Tickets Available At Doors Tonight–Come to SCSU’s Ritsche Auditorium to Rock It Local

twilighthours.jpgKVSC 88.1FM presents Rockin’ It Local: A Minnesota Music Showcase.  The free concert headlines The Twilight Hours featuring John Munson and Matt Wilson with special guests Roma di Luna.  The free concert is Friday, April 30 at 7:30 p.m. in Ritsche Auditorium on the St. Cloud State campus.  Tickets are needed to attend this free concert.  They’re available online at scsutickets.com and the Atwood Center information desk.

The Twilight Hours’ new album Stereo Night has been described as having "lavish harmonies, emotionally resonant lyricism, and some fiery fretwork…" (City Pages).  The duo has been together since the late 1980’s splitting ways in the mid-90’s.  Wilson went out on his own and Munson formed Semisonic with Wilson’s brother Dan. 

Roma di Luna has a traditional folk sound with a modern take.  "Their edgy, starry-night country/folk music is nicely filled in with softly plunked banjo, pretty violin and pristine electric guitar parts" (Star Tribune).

This free concert is paid for with support from the Minnesota Arts and Cultural Heritage Fund.
